原文:大规模微服务单元化与高可用设计

说到大规模微服务系统,往往是一些 时不间断运行的在线系统,这样的系统往往有以下的要求: 第一,高可用。这类的系统往往需要保持一定的SLA的, 时不间断运行不代表完全不挂,而是有一定的百分比的。例如我们常说的可用性需达到 个 . ,全年停机总计不能超过 小时,约为 分钟,也即服务停用时间小于 分钟,就说明高可用设计合格。 第二,用户分布在全国。大规模微服务系统所支撑的用户一般在全国各地,因而每个地区 ...

2019-09-24 10:50 8 3640 推荐指数:

查看详情

支付平台架构师谈大规模并发服务系统设计经验

本文转自简书作者:李艳鹏原文链接:http://www.jianshu.com/p/1156151e20c8 作者简介: 李艳鹏支付平台架构师,专注线上和线下支付平台的应用架构和技术架构的规划与落地,负责交易、支付、渠道、账务、计费、风控、对账等系统的设计与实现,在移动支付 ...

Fri Apr 28 22:55:00 CST 2017 0 4473
浅谈大规模并发服务的伸缩问题

什么是大规模并发? 大规模并发是两个词,前者表示有大量的流量访问,后者表示竞争状态下并发可能会遇到的一致性和可用性问题。 有什么问题? 如果只是大规模的流量,我们可以简单的进行负载均衡和针对架构层面的优化就能解决,这一块和业务并无直接联系。 但是并发就不一样了,就算只有不太 ...

Wed Oct 09 20:07:00 CST 2019 0 577
微服务可用方案

微服务可用方案 一、微服务可用 在注册中心、配置中心高可用方案之前,了解一下注册中心的工作原理,下面分为两个部分来解释,一是注册中心和各个微服务的注册表的获取与同步,二是注册中心如何去维护注册表。 1.1、注册表的获取与同步 Eureka Server和Eureka Client之间 ...

Mon Jul 22 08:54:00 CST 2019 1 1450
falcon 可靠高性能的构建大规模应用以及微服务的 python web 框架

falcon 是一个额可靠高性能的构建大规模应用以及微服务的 python web 框架,主要支持的python 版本为3.6+ 可以与wsgi 以及asgi 兼容,而且还支持cpython,以下是一个简单的试用 python 的版本管理基于pyenv,具体使用参考相关文档 环境 ...

Wed Aug 26 04:31:00 CST 2020 0 923
微服务9:服务治理来保证可用

微服务系列 微服务1:微服务及其演进史 微服务2:微服务全景架构 微服务3:微服务拆分策略 微服务4:服务注册与发现 微服务5:服务注册与发现(实践篇) 微服务6:通信之网关 微服务7:通信之RPC 微服务8:通信之RPC实践篇(附源码) 微服务9:服务治理来保证可用 1 微服务带来 ...

Fri May 06 22:25:00 CST 2022 1 3012
可用架构演进之单元

摘要:华为云IoT提供了一站式的物联网应用开发的基础能力,这些能力做到可用是非常不容易的,那到底是怎么做到的呢? 本文分享自华为云社区《【云驻共创】可用架构演进之单元》,作者:咸蛋超人。 单元可用架构当中的一个杀手锏。本文主要是想重点分享一下可用架构演进之单元,总共分为 ...

Tue Aug 17 18:02:00 CST 2021 0 258
微服务实战——可用的SpringCloudConfig

管理微服务配置 对于单体应用架构来说,会使用配置文件管理我们的配置,这就是之前项目中的application.properties或application.yml。如果需要在多环境下使用,传统的做法是复制这些文件命名为application-xxx.properties,并且在启动时配置 ...

Wed Apr 01 02:46:00 CST 2020 0 613
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M